Refractometric total protein concentrations in icteric serum from dogs.

作者信息

Gupta Aradhana, Stockham Steven L

机构信息

Department of Diagnostic Medicine and Pathobiology, College of Veterinary Medicine, Kansas State University, Manhattan, KS 66506.

出版信息

J Am Vet Med Assoc. 2014 Jan 1;244(1):63-7. doi: 10.2460/javma.244.1.63.

DOI:10.2460/javma.244.1.63
PMID:24344854
Abstract

OBJECTIVE

To determine whether high serum bilirubin concentrations interfere with the measurement of serum total protein concentration by refractometry and to assess potential biases among refractometer measurements.

DESIGN

Evaluation study.

SAMPLE

Sera from 2 healthy Greyhounds.

PROCEDURES

Bilirubin was dissolved in 0.1M NaOH, and the resulting solution was mixed with sera from 2 dogs from which food had been withheld to achieve various bilirubin concentrations up to 40 mg/dL. Refractometric total protein concentrations were estimated with 3 clinical refractometers. A biochemical analyzer was used to measure biuret assay-based total protein and bilirubin concentrations with spectrophotometric assays.

RESULTS

No interference with refractometric measurement of total protein concentrations was detected with bilirubin concentrations up to 41.5 mg/dL. Biases in refractometric total protein concentrations were detected and were related to the conversion of refractive index values to total protein concentrations.

CONCLUSIONS AND CLINICAL RELEVANCE

Hyperbilirubinemia did not interfere with the refractometric estimation of serum total protein concentration. The agreement among total protein concentrations estimated by 3 refractometers was dependent on the method of conversion of refractive index to total protein concentration and was independent of hyperbilirubinemia.

摘要

目的

确定高血清胆红素浓度是否会干扰折射法测定血清总蛋白浓度,并评估折射仪测量之间的潜在偏差。

设计

评估研究。

样本

来自2只健康灵缇犬的血清。

程序

将胆红素溶解于0.1M氢氧化钠中,所得溶液与2只禁食犬的血清混合,以达到高达40mg/dL的各种胆红素浓度。使用3台临床折射仪估算折射法总蛋白浓度。使用生化分析仪通过分光光度法测量基于双缩脲法的总蛋白和胆红素浓度。

结果

胆红素浓度高达41.5mg/dL时,未检测到对总蛋白浓度折射法测量的干扰。检测到折射法总蛋白浓度存在偏差,且与折射率值转换为总蛋白浓度有关。

结论及临床意义

高胆红素血症不干扰血清总蛋白浓度的折射法估算。3台折射仪估算的总蛋白浓度之间的一致性取决于折射率转换为总蛋白浓度的方法,且与高胆红素血症无关。
